The Unique Air Quality Challenges in Your Wesley Chapel Home
Living in Wesley Chapel offers a beautiful lifestyle, but it also presents distinct challenges for indoor air quality. Florida's high humidity is a primary concern, creating an ideal environment for mold, mildew, and dust mites to thrive within your home and HVAC system. Seasonal pollen from local flora can easily infiltrate your living spaces, triggering allergies and respiratory discomfort. Furthermore, ongoing local development can introduce fine dust and particulate matter into the air, while common household items release Volatile Organic Compounds (VOCs). These elements combine to create an indoor environment that can aggravate asthma, cause allergic reactions, lead to persistent odors, and contribute to a constant layer of dust on your surfaces.
Comprehensive Air Filtration Systems for Cleaner, Healthier Air
A single, standard furnace filter is often insufficient to capture the microscopic particles that pose the greatest risk. We offer a multi-layered approach to air purification, integrating advanced technologies directly into your HVAC system for whole-home protection.
High-Efficiency HEPA Filtration
At the core of superior air cleaning is high-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) filtration. These systems are rated using the Minimum Efficiency Reporting Value (MERV) scale. While standard filters might have a MERV rating of 1-4, our professional-grade solutions often utilize filters with a MERV rating of 13 or higher. A higher MERV rating indicates a greater ability to capture smaller particles. These advanced filters are incredibly effective at trapping common irritants such as fine dust, pet dander, pollen, mold spores, and even some bacteria and virus-carrying droplets, removing them from circulation before they ever reach your living spaces.
UV Germicidal Air Purifiers
To combat the biological threats that thrive in Florida's humid climate, we install UV germicidal lights within your HVAC system. These powerful UV-C lamps are strategically placed to irradiate the indoor coil and air handler, areas prone to microbial growth. As air circulates through the system, the UV light neutralizes the DNA of airborne viruses, bacteria, and mold spores, rendering them harmless. This technology is a proactive defense against the spread of illness and helps keep the internal components of your HVAC system clean and efficient.
Activated Carbon Filters for Odor and Chemical Removal
Lingering odors from pets, cooking, or cleaning products can make a home feel less than fresh. Activated carbon filters are the definitive solution for these issues. The porous surface of the carbon traps and absorbs odor-causing molecules and chemical vapors. This technology is especially effective at removing VOCs, which are gaseous chemicals emitted from paints, furniture, carpets, and household cleaners. Integrating an activated carbon filter results in air that doesn't just feel cleaner—it smells cleaner, too.

Maintaining Your System for Long-Term Performance
An advanced air filtration system is a long-term investment in your home’s health. To ensure it performs at its peak, proper maintenance is essential. Each type of system has a specific maintenance schedule. High-efficiency media filters require periodic replacement, while UV lamps need to be changed annually to maintain their germicidal effectiveness. Our technicians provide clear guidance on these schedules and can incorporate the upkeep of your air quality components into a regular HVAC maintenance plan.
